Zusammenfassung
Structural studies by 1H NMR of 12 orthopalladated complexes of the type: {Pd2(μ-Y)2(C10H21OC6H4C(X)NC6H4R)2} (XH, CH3; YOCOCH3, Cl, Br, SCN; ROC10H21, C10H21) are reported. Although in all cases only the trans isomers of these complexes have been observed, the presence of other types of isomerism has been detected. Thus, the thiocyanate complexes show isomers arising from the relative disposition of the asymmetrical bridging ligands, whereas the acetato-bridged complexes must be a mixture of the D and L enantiomers due to their rigid open-book shape. From the results of different spectroscopic studies (low temperature and selective decoupling) carried out on the ketone-derived imine complex {Pd2(μ-OCOCH3)2(C10H21OC6H4C(CH3)NC6H4C10H21)2} we suggest that a structural distortion due to steric hindrances exists for this compound. © 1989.
